Join us for our winter drawing weekend in the glorious forest garden setting of ‘High Dalby House‘, in the heart of Dalby Forest, North Yorkshire Moors National Park. https://www.highdalbyhouse.com/

The retreat explores drawing as a way of noticing, of slowing down and connecting with nature and the seasons. In this inspiring setting, you’ll develop a range of drawing skills and techniques using different drawing materials, exploring what inspires you as an artist. The residential option includes luxury accommodation, good food and a chance to relax and be inspired in the company of others.

The retreats are led by professional artists and sisters Rachel and Kathryn Welford. Both are skilled in drawing and explore nature as part of their artistic practice. https://www.rachelwelford.co.uk/about

Designed as a set of four seasonal retreats, each weekend can be 'stand-alone' or experienced together, building on skills and approaches explored in previous seasons and throughout the year. The Winter Retreat will focus on capturing tone and line, the subtleties of light and dark and the quiet detail of nature in slumber.

What will I learn?

  • Various techniques with different drawing media (pencil, charcoal, pastel and inks)
  • How to adapt your technique for different scales, working in sketchbooks and large paper.
  • Different approaches to drawing, i.e. observational drawing to experimental mark-making.
  • How to work outdoors, directly in nature.
  • How to look closely, notice and understand how your subject matter inspires you.
